Lemon Curd
½ tsp. vanilla extract
½ cup sugar
1 T. cornstarch
1/4 cup plant milk
¼ cup lemon juice
2 tsp. lemon zest
In a small saucepan over low heat add the sugar, cornstarch, lemon zest and juice. Whisk the ingredients all together and then add the milk. Turn the heat to a medium high and continue whisking for about 5 minutes or until the mixture comes together to coat the back of a spoon well. Once it is a good consistency, stir in the vanilla extract and transfer the lemon curd to a bowl, let cool completely.
I made some vegan sugar cookies and let the kids spread a good dollop of lemon curd on the tops of them all for a yummy treat!
You can find tons of simple vegan sugar cookie recipes online and if you don’t have time to bake from scratch, just buy some pre-made cookie dough at the store! The Sweet Loren’s brand, which is widely available, is awesome, vegan and gluten free! Sprinkle the tops with some powdered sugar and enjoy!
